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om West Side Waterside South End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in West Side Waterside South End with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in West Side Waterside South End is at Bayview Towers listed at $1,535.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om West Side Waterside South End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in West Side Waterside South End is $4,017.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om West Side Waterside South End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in West Side Waterside South End is a 1,858 square feet unit starting from $6,435 at Escape.

What is the average size for West Side Waterside South End 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in West Side Waterside South End is currently 1,611 sq ft.
